Tips for Finding Social Work Case Manager Jobs at Lutheran Social Services of Illinois Jobs

Get Your MSW Credential Evaluated Early

LSSI roles typically require a Master of Social Work from a CSWE-accredited program. If your degree is from outside the U.S., get a credential evaluation from NACES before applying. Foreign social work degrees without accreditation equivalency can stall the process significantly.

Target LSSI's Refugee and Resettlement Openings

LSSI runs one of Illinois' largest refugee resettlement programs, and those case manager roles tend to have higher turnover and consistent need. Focusing your applications there gives you the best odds of landing a position where the hire is genuinely urgent.

Confirm Illinois Licensure Path Before Your Interview

Many LSSI Social Work Case Manager roles require or prefer a Licensed Social Worker credential. On an F-1 OPT, you can start work before obtaining full licensure, but confirm this during your interview so there are no surprises around your start date or supervised hours requirement.

Ask HR Directly About H-1B Filing Timelines

USCIS H-1B cap registration opens in March, and employers must commit early. When you receive an offer, ask LSSI's HR team whether they plan to file in the current cap cycle or pursue a cap-exempt route through their nonprofit status, which could allow year-round filing.

Understand Your 60-Day Grace Period Before Accepting an Offer

If you're transitioning between employers on an H-1B or finishing OPT, you have a 60-day grace period after your previous employment ends. LSSI's onboarding and credentialing process can take several weeks, so time your resignation and start date carefully to stay in status.

Frequently Asked Questions

Does Lutheran Social Services of Illinois sponsor H-1B visas for Social Work Case Managers?

Yes, Lutheran Social Services of Illinois has sponsored H-1B visas for Social Work Case Manager roles. As a nonprofit organization, LSSI may qualify for cap-exempt H-1B filing, which means they can submit petitions to USCIS outside the standard annual lottery window. Confirm cap-exempt eligibility directly with their HR team when you receive an offer, as it significantly affects your filing timeline.

Which visa types are commonly used for Social Work Case Manager roles at Lutheran Social Services of Illinois?

LSSI has sponsored H-1B visas for Social Work Case Manager roles and has also worked with candidates on F-1 OPT, F-1 CPT, TN, and J-1 visas. Social work qualifies as a specialty occupation under H-1B because it requires at minimum a bachelor's degree in social work or a related field, though most LSSI case manager positions prefer or require an MSW. TN status applies to Canadian and Mexican nationals in qualifying social work roles.

What qualifications does Lutheran Social Services of Illinois expect for Social Work Case Manager roles?

Most LSSI Social Work Case Manager positions require at minimum a bachelor's degree in social work, psychology, or a related human services field, with many roles preferring or requiring an MSW. Illinois licensure as an LSW or LCSW is frequently listed as a requirement or preferred qualification. Relevant experience in behavioral health, refugee services, or disability case management is a strong differentiator given LSSI's program scope.

How long does the visa sponsorship and hiring process typically take at Lutheran Social Services of Illinois?

From offer to work authorization, timelines vary by visa type. H-1B standard processing through USCIS takes three to six months, though nonprofit cap-exempt filings can sometimes move faster. F-1 OPT transfers require submitting an employer update with your Designated School Official before your current OPT end date. Build at least four to eight weeks of buffer into your start date negotiation to account for LSSI's internal credentialing and onboarding requirements.
